The “Urban” School Of Food
Reading Time: 5 minutes Joe Nasr (left) starts out by telling me what his course is not about. “It’s not food safety,” says Nasr, instructor in food security at Ryerson University. He explains that the concept encompasses whether people have reliable access to food, whether that food is appropriate, whether it is affordable, and whether it is nutritionally balanced.
